I would like to report that I achieved my first strict pull-up yesterday! When I started CrossFit in early June, I hadn’t had the upper-body strength to do pull-ups since grade school. I thought it would take much longer to get to the point where I could - my goal was within 6 months - but, now, not more than 2 and 1/2 months later, I did it.

I am always so awed by the numbers some of you folks put up and laugh when I post my very much smaller numbers next to yours. But, this stuff works, even for a 45 year old woman with an arthritic back - a back that got much better within a week of starting CrossFit, when I was able to drop the pain meds, and has stayed better this whole time. Some of the lifting has been scary, but I keep it light and slow and study the main-site videos over and over before I try anything.
